Tamara de Lempicka: Goddess of the Automobile Age is an in-depth exploration of the life and work of this iconic artist. Born into a Russian aristocratic family, de Lempicka fled her homeland after the Bolshevik revolution and established herself as a leading figure in Parisian society. Her art is characterized by its unique blend of cool colors, tight post-cubist forms, and sensual, neoclassical figuration. De Lempicka's subjects often appear aloof and powerful, yet seductive and alluring, with a haughty grandeur that commands attention. Through her portraits, including Women Bathing and Portrait of Suzy Solidor, de Lempicka offers a privileged glimpse into the lives of high-society patrons and emancipated women. This book provides an introduction to de Lempicka's visual language and its significance in the history of interwar art and female artists. With its unique blend of glamour, sophistication, and female independence, Tamara de Lempicka: Goddess of the Automobile Age is a fascinating study of one of the 20th century's most influential artists.
